What I will do for you
- Step 1
Womens' Colour Analysis - £99.00 including workbook.
During this class you will be inspired by discovering the colours that best suit you for clothes, shoes, hair and make-up. I will show you what works with your skintone, enabling you to buy a wardrobe of clothes that all work together. You will receive a leather wallet containing your Season's colours and a booklet to remind you of your best colour 'ratings' and makeup choices.
Here is a short video demontrating what happens in a colour analysis class.
- Step 2
Womens' Style Class - £130.00 including workbook.
Are you an Ectomorph or an Endomorph? Could you be a Romantic Natural, a Gamine Ingenue or a Dramatic Classic? Find out on this class where you will discover the perfect styles and shapes to suit your body type and personality.
- Step 3
Make-up Class - £40.00 including workbook.
Learn how to apply make-up to achieve a healthly glow using the right colours for your skintone and eyes. This is a must for anyone who lacks confidence when playing around with makeup or who feels it takes too long to apply in the morning. I will show you how you can achieve the perfect look in six minutes!
